** The Dodge repair market serving Allenwood, PA, is characterized by a few highly specialized performance shops amidst a larger number of general automotive repair centers. Due to Allenwood's small size and rural nature, residents must typically travel to the commercial hubs of Montoursville or Williamsport for expert-level service. * **Average Quality:** The general market quality is average for routine maintenance. However, for the specific high-performance specialties requested (Hellcat, SRT, tuning), the quality is exceptionally high but limited to a small number of elite providers like KCR Performance.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ate. There are many shops, but only 2-3 possess the specific tools, software, and certified expertise to properly service and tune modern high-performance Dodges. This allows the top specialists to command a premium.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is tiered. General HEMI repair and transmission service is competitive with regional averages. However, SRT-specific work, performance tuning, and supercharger service are premium services. Labor rates for these specialties can be 25-50% higher than standard repair rates, reflecting the required expertise and investment in specialized equipment.

Given the rural roads and seasonal weather in the Allenwood region, we frequently address suspension components, brake wear, and 4x4 system concerns on Dodge trucks and SUVs. For Dodge Caravans and Chargers, electrical issues and transmission services are also very common as vehicles age and accumulate mileage from local commuting.

The winter road treatments and seasonal potholes common in Pennsylvania necessitate close attention to undercarriage rust prevention, tire condition, and alignment. Furthermore, preparing your Dodge's cooling system for summer and battery for cold Valley winters are essential local maintenance priorities.
